The country is now moving towards unlocking amidst the decreasing cases of Corona. All the monuments and museums under the supervision of the central government will be opened from June 16. This information has been given by the Archaeological Survey of India.
The decline in the cases of corona in the country continues. On Sunday, 68,362 new infections were identified in the country. 1 lakh 13 thousand 3 patients were cured, while 3,880 people died. In the last 24 hours, the number of active cases, ie the number of patients undergoing treatment, decreased by 48,593. Now only 9 lakh 72 thousand 577 patients are being treated. This is less than the first peak that came on September 17 last year. Then there were 10 lakh 17 thousand 705 active cases. After that, they decreased.
Active cases reached 1 lakh 33 thousand 79 on February 17 this year. From here this figure started moving towards the second peak. It reached the highest number of 37 lakh 41 thousand 302 on 9 May, then it started declining.

Restrictions like lockdown in 12 states
There are restrictions like complete lockdown in 12 states of the country. These include Himachal Pradesh, Jharkhand, Chhattisgarh, Odisha, Karnataka, Kerala, Tamil Nadu, Mizoram, Goa, Telangana, West Bengal, and Puducherry. Strict restrictions have been imposed here as in the previous lockdown.
Partial lockdown in 20 states/UTs
There is a partial lockdown in 20 states and union territories of the country. That is, there are restrictions here, but there are also exemptions. These include Bihar, Delhi, Maharashtra, Rajasthan, Uttar Pradesh, Madhya Pradesh, Haryana, Punjab, Jammu, and Kashmir, Ladakh, Uttarakhand, Arunachal Pradesh, Sikkim, Meghalaya, Nagaland, Assam, Manipur, Tripura, Andhra Pradesh, and Gujarat.
